- Real name
- Arthur Reed Ropes
- Born
- December 23, 1859
- Died
- September 11, 1933
- Country
- United Kingdom
- Comments
- Prolific writer of lyrics, contributing songs to more than sixty British musical comedies in the late 19th and early 20th century. He was the most important lyricist of the British stage during a career that spanned five decades. At a time when few shows had long runs, nineteen of his West End shows ran for over 400 performances.
